package com.panzhihua.service_community.model.dos;
|
|
import com.baomidou.mybatisplus.annotation.*;
|
import lombok.Data;
|
|
import java.io.Serializable;
|
import java.math.BigDecimal;
|
import java.util.Date;
|
|
/**
|
* @ClassName: ComShopFlowerOrder
|
* @Author: yh
|
* @Date: 2022/11/9 16:46
|
* @Description: 花城订单表
|
*/
|
|
@TableName(value = "com_shop_flower_order")
|
@Data
|
public class ComShopFlowerOrderDO implements Serializable {
|
private static final long serialVersionUID = 1L;
|
/**
|
* 订单id
|
*/
|
@TableId(type = IdType.ASSIGN_ID)
|
private Long id;
|
|
/**
|
* 店铺id
|
*/
|
@TableField(value = "store_id")
|
private Long storeId;
|
|
/**
|
* 用户id
|
*/
|
@TableField(value = "user_id")
|
private Long userId;
|
|
/**
|
* 订单号
|
*/
|
@TableField(value = "order_no")
|
private String orderNo;
|
|
/**
|
* 支付单号
|
*/
|
@TableField(value = "pay_no")
|
private String payNo;
|
|
/**
|
* 微信交易单号
|
*/
|
@TableField(value = "wx_tarde_no")
|
private String wxTardeNo;
|
|
/**
|
* 订单状态(1.等待配送 2.配送中 3.待收货 4.待评价 5.已完成 6.已取消 7.已退款)
|
*/
|
@TableField(value = "status")
|
private Integer status;
|
|
/**
|
* 支付状态(1.未支付 2.已支付)
|
*/
|
@TableField(value = "pay_status")
|
private Integer payStatus;
|
|
/**
|
* 订单收货人id
|
*/
|
@TableField(value = "receiver_id")
|
private Long receiverId;
|
|
/**
|
* 删除状态(1.未删除 2.已删除)
|
*/
|
@TableField(value = "delete_status")
|
private Integer deleteStatus;
|
|
/**
|
* 订单总金额
|
*/
|
@TableField(value = "total_amount")
|
private BigDecimal totalAmount;
|
|
/**
|
* 优惠总金额
|
*/
|
@TableField(value = "discount_amount")
|
private BigDecimal discountAmount;
|
|
/**
|
* 支付总金额
|
*/
|
@TableField(value = "pay_amount")
|
private BigDecimal payAmount;
|
|
/**
|
* 支付方式(1.微信支付)
|
*/
|
@TableField(value = "pay_type")
|
private Integer payType;
|
|
/**
|
* 支付时间
|
*/
|
@TableField(value = "pay_time")
|
private Date payTime;
|
|
/**
|
* 配送方式(1.自提 2.快递)
|
*/
|
@TableField(value = "delivery_type")
|
private Integer deliveryType;
|
|
/**
|
* 订单发货状态(1.未发货 2.已发货)
|
*/
|
@TableField(value = "delivery_status")
|
private Integer deliveryStatus;
|
|
/**
|
* 订单备注
|
*/
|
@TableField(value = "remark")
|
private String remark;
|
|
/**
|
* 物流公司
|
*/
|
@TableField(value = "logistics_company")
|
private String logisticsCompany;
|
|
/**
|
* 物流单号
|
*/
|
@TableField(value = "logistics_no")
|
private String logisticsNo;
|
|
/**
|
* 下单时间
|
*/
|
@TableField(value = "create_at",fill = FieldFill.INSERT)
|
private Date createAt;
|
|
/**
|
* 修改时间
|
*/
|
@TableField(value = "update_at",fill = FieldFill.UPDATE)
|
private Date updateAt;
|
|
/**
|
* 配送时间
|
*/
|
@TableField(value = "delivery_time")
|
private Date deliveryTime;
|
|
/**
|
* 送达时间
|
*/
|
@TableField(value = "service_time")
|
private Date serviceTime;
|
|
/**
|
* 收货时间
|
*/
|
@TableField(value = "receiving_time")
|
private Date receivingTime;
|
|
/**
|
* 退款时间
|
*/
|
@TableField(value = "refund_time")
|
private Date refundTime;
|
|
/**
|
* 自提点id
|
*/
|
private Long pointId;
|
|
/**
|
* 配送单id
|
*/
|
private Long deliveryId;
|
|
/**
|
* 配送单号
|
*/
|
private String deliveryNo;
|
|
/**
|
* 订单状态(1.等待配送 2.配送中 3.待收货 4.待评价 5.已完成 6.已取消 7.已退款 8.待发货)
|
*/
|
public interface status {
|
int dfk = 0;
|
int ddps = 1;
|
int psz = 2;
|
int dsh = 3;
|
int dpj = 4;
|
int ywc = 5;
|
int yqx = 6;
|
int ytk = 7;
|
int dfh = 8;
|
}
|
|
/**
|
* 支付状态(1.未支付 2.已支付)
|
*/
|
public interface payStatus {
|
int no = 1;
|
int yes = 2;
|
}
|
|
/**
|
* 删除状态(1.未删除 2.已删除)
|
*/
|
public interface deleteStatus {
|
int no = 1;
|
int yes = 2;
|
}
|
|
/**
|
* 支付方式(1.微信支付)
|
*/
|
public interface payType {
|
int wx = 1;
|
}
|
|
/**
|
* 配送方式(1.商家配送 2.快递物流)
|
*/
|
public interface deliveryType {
|
int store = 1;
|
int express = 2;
|
}
|
|
/**
|
* 订单发货状态(1.未发货 2.已发货)
|
*/
|
public interface deliveryStatus {
|
int no = 1;
|
int yes = 2;
|
}
|
|
@Override
|
public String toString() {
|
return "ComShopFlowerOrderDO{" +
|
"id=" + id +
|
", storeId=" + storeId +
|
", userId=" + userId +
|
", orderNo='" + orderNo + '\'' +
|
", payNo='" + payNo + '\'' +
|
", wxTardeNo='" + wxTardeNo + '\'' +
|
", status=" + status +
|
", payStatus=" + payStatus +
|
", receiverId=" + receiverId +
|
", deleteStatus=" + deleteStatus +
|
", totalAmount=" + totalAmount +
|
", discountAmount=" + discountAmount +
|
", payAmount=" + payAmount +
|
", payType=" + payType +
|
", payTime=" + payTime +
|
", deliveryType=" + deliveryType +
|
", deliveryStatus=" + deliveryStatus +
|
", remark='" + remark + '\'' +
|
", logisticsCompany='" + logisticsCompany + '\'' +
|
", logisticsNo='" + logisticsNo + '\'' +
|
", createAt=" + createAt +
|
", updateAt=" + updateAt +
|
", deliveryTime=" + deliveryTime +
|
", serviceTime=" + serviceTime +
|
", receivingTime=" + receivingTime +
|
", refundTime=" + refundTime +
|
'}';
|
}
|
}
|